The Guy is a nameless marijuana dealer in Brooklyn who delivers his goods via bicycle to stressed-out clients across New York City, who try to savour the highs of life in an increasingly volatile world. While dropping off weed to his customers, he makes brief appearances in their lives to get a glimpse at their daily routines, allowing viewers to explore the existences of intriguing, colorful individuals from all walks of life. The comedy series stars Ben Sinclair, who created the show with then-wife Katja Blichfeld, as The Guy.

Episodes

Episode 1 Aired Feb 7, 2020 Cycles The Guy finds a lost canine; a reporter pitches a story about her parents' marriage and inadvertently strains her own relationship when her boyfriend visits for their anniversary weekend; a singing telegram in a bad mood looks for some relief. Details Episode 2 Aired Feb 14, 2020 Trick The Guy delivers to Matthew, a man looking for a connection who hires a new-to-the-business escort for the night; after bonding on set with a familiar face, intimacy coordinator Kym learns a surprising fact about her new love interest. Details Episode 3 Aired Feb 21, 2020 Voire Dire When The Guy and his eclectic jury duty group head to a karaoke bar to mark the end of their civic service, Keesha and Roman run into trouble; while exploring a side hustle with her friend Violet, Freddie encounters someone from her past. Details Episode 4 Aired Feb 28, 2020 Backflash Two sisters clean out their childhood home after the untimely death of their mother; the Guy delivers to a bickering couple renegotiating their relationship; a new mother hosts her teenage cousin from out of town. Details Episode 5 Aired Mar 6, 2020 Screen Shy sneaker head Alvin gets a new challenge when he spends the day with his cousin; the Guy attends a dinner party hosted by an old friend, Jackson, and realizes he might be out of his element as the night progresses. Details Episode 6 Aired Mar 13, 2020 Adelante When a patient asks her out on a date, dental hygienist Nora wonders if she can put her needs first for once; two former friends share an awkward ride, and the Guy has an interesting ride-share experience of his own. Details Episode 7 Aired Mar 20, 2020 Hand The Guy delivers to ASL interpreter Jordan, who lands in an uncomfortable situation on a job at a high-profile photo shoot; after Victor notices that his partner, Ellen, has a new habit, a secret blows up amid already simmering tensions. Details Episode 8 Aired Mar 27, 2020 Solo When Rocky hears a sneeze through his apartment wall, he falls down a shame spiral, reliving embarrassing moments; A.J. fails to make plans for Halloween until a text from ex-friend Francis evolves into a night with Francis' assistant, Cheyenne. Details Episode 9 Aired Apr 3, 2020 Soup When a snowstorm hits on Christmas Eve, Pam-Anne joins her sister, Destiny, and a motley crew of flight attendants at their crash pad in Queens; delayed on his way home to spend the holidays with his family, the Guy celebrates Hanukkah in New York.
